An extraordinarily bright isolated star has been found in a nearby galaxy — the star is three million times brighter than the Sun. All previous similar "superstars" were found in star clusters, but this brilliant beacon shines in solitary splendour. The origin of this star is mysterious: did it form in isolation or was it ejected from a cluster? Either option challenges astronomers' understanding of star formation.
An international team of astronomers has used ESO's Very Large Telescope to carefully study the star VFTS 682 in the Large Magellanic Cloud, a small neighboring galaxy to the Milky Way. By analyzing the star's light, using the FLAMES instrument on the VLT, they have found that it is about 150 times the mass of the Sun. Stars like these have so far only been found in the crowded centers of star clusters, but VFTS 682 lies on its own.
